Preparing the Site: Key Steps

Proper site preparation is vital for a successful concrete installation process. Initially, the area must be cleared of debris, vegetation, and any existing structures. This step ensures a clean, stable foundation. Following this, the soil is evaluated for compaction and drainage capabilities; if necessary, it may be compacted or treated to enhance stability. Next, proper grading is performed to establish a level surface and facilitate water runoff. Installing forms is also necessary, as they define the shape and dimensions of the concrete pour. Finally, reinforcing materials, such as rebar or wire mesh, are positioned to enhance the concrete's strength. Proper execution of these steps lays the groundwork for a durable and reliable concrete structure.

Curing Process Importance

While frequently disregarded, the curing process plays an essential role in the success of a concrete installation. This phase begins immediately after the concrete is poured and requires preserving adequate moisture, temperature, and time to permit the concrete to attain its intended strength and durability. Proper curing avoids problems like cracking, surface scaling, and weaknesses in the material. Techniques may include placing over the surface wet burlap, employing curing compounds, or applying plastic sheeting to keep moisture in. Typically, the curing period ranges from a few days to several weeks, based on environmental conditions and the specific concrete mix used. Understanding the significance of this process ensures that the final structure remains reliable and long-lasting, meeting the expectations of clients.

Routine Cleaning Methods

Consistent maintenance practices are crucial for sustaining the long-term condition and aesthetics of concrete surfaces. Routine maintenance, including removing debris and dirt, helps prevent staining and deterioration. Power washing can effectively remove stubborn marks, algae, or moss that may build up over time. It is suggested to use a soft cleanser during this process to minimize chemical damage. Furthermore, promptly handling spills, specifically from oil or chemicals, can prevent permanent discoloration. In cold weather regions, eliminating snow and ice is critical to prevent cracking due to freezing and thawing. Routine checks for cracks or surface wear can also support identifying issues early, making certain that concrete surfaces remain durable and visually appealing for years to come.

Frequency of Sealant Application

Normally, putting on a sealant to concrete surfaces every 1-3 years is vital for maintaining their structural integrity and visual appeal. This timeline relies on factors such as weather conditions, foot traffic, and the type of sealant used. Routine inspections can help determine when reapplication is necessary; indicators like discoloration, wear, or water penetration demonstrate that the sealant has deteriorated. Homeowners should pick superior sealants intended for their specific concrete applications, guaranteeing better durability. In addition, proper surface preparation before application improves adhesion and effectiveness. By adhering to this maintenance schedule, property owners can shield their concrete investments, extending the lifespan of surfaces and reducing costly repairs in the future.

Advancements and Emerging Trends in Advanced Concrete Methods

How is the concrete industry evolving to meet the demands of a rapidly changing world? Breakthroughs in concrete technology are creating a more sustainable and robust future. Researchers are designing eco-friendly alternatives, such as recycled aggregates and bio-based additives, which reduce the carbon footprint of concrete production. Moreover, developments in smart concrete—embedding sensors that monitor structural health—enable proactive maintenance, improving safety and durability.

An additional emerging trend is the use of 3D printing innovation, allowing for fast construction of sophisticated structures with limited waste. Furthermore, self-healing concrete, which utilizes bacteria or alternative materials to repair cracks autonomously, is building traction, offering extended-life infrastructure systems.

While urbanization advances and climate change shapes construction approaches, these innovations reflect the industry's dedication to sustainability and efficiency. The future of concrete technology possesses tremendous capacity for transforming how society builds, providing structures that are resilient and environmentally sustainable.

How Much Time Does Concrete Usually Need to Cure Fully?

Concrete normally takes roughly 28 days to achieve complete curing, even though initial hardening takes place within hours. Elements including temperature, humidity, and mix design can impact the curing process and overall strength development.

What Kinds of Concrete Finishes Can You Choose From?

Multiple concrete finishes include polished, stamped, exposed aggregate, brushed, and troweled. Each finish features unique aesthetics and textures, serving varying design preferences and functional requirements in both residential and commercial applications.

Is Concrete Pouring Possible in Cold Weather Conditions?

Indeed, concrete can be poured in cold weather, but particular precautions are essential. Proper techniques and materials, such as heated water and insulating blankets, help make certain the concrete cures successfully despite lower temperatures.

What's the Best Course of Action if My Concrete Cracks?

When cracks form in concrete, evaluate the scope of the damage. Small fissures can be filled with a concrete patching compound, while larger cracks could necessitate professional evaluation and repair to ensure structural integrity and prevent future damage.

How Can I Determine if My Concrete Needs Resurfacing?

To evaluate whether concrete requires resurfacing, one should look for obvious cracks, uneven surfaces, or discoloration. Additionally, pooling water or a rough texture might suggest that resurfacing is necessary for superior aesthetics and functionality.
